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, STEP has two clearly defined near-term levels that traders are monitoring closely. Immediate support sits at $50.00, a price point that has acted as a consistent floor for the stock in recent trading sessions, with bounces recorded on each prior test of this level. Immediate resistance is set at $55.26, a level that has capped prior upside attempts, with selling pressure emerging each time the stock has approached this threshold in recent weeks.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-50s, indicating neutral to slightly bullish momentum with no signs of extreme overbought or oversold conditions that would signal an imminent trend reversal. STEP is also trading above both its short-term and medium-term moving averages, a pattern that many technical analysts view as an indication of positive near-term trend momentum. The elevated volume accompanying the recent gain adds further credibility to the strength of the current upward move, per standard technical analysis frameworks. Outlook

Looking ahead, STEP is approaching a key inflection point as it trades between its defined support and resistance levels. If the stock were to test and break above the $55.26 resistance level on sustained high volume, it could open up potential for further upside movement, with traders likely watching for follow-through buying interest to confirm the breakout. Conversely, if upward momentum fades in the upcoming sessions, STEP might retest the $50.00 support level, with market participants observing whether this level holds as a floor to prevent further downside. Broader market trends, including shifts in interest rate expectations and changes in institutional allocation to alternative assets, could also impact STEP’s price action in the near term, as these factors directly influence the operating environment for StepStone Group Inc. Analysts note that sector flows into asset management names will be a key trend to monitor for context around any potential breakout or breakdown from the current trading range.
